Explanation
Data on the SD card can be damaged due to the following reasons. Please
format the SD card.
• Could the power have been turned off during recording or playback?
• Could the SD card have been subjected to strong physical shock?
• Could you have turned off the power while the SD card was being accessed?
• Could you be using an SD card that was formatted by a computer or digital
camera?
Could the SD card be write protected?
Could an SD card not supported by the BR-80 be inserted?
Before using any SD card other than the one that was supplied with the unit,
please refer to the Roland website (http://www.roland.com).
There you'll find the latest information regarding compatibility.
Explanation
Is the USB cable connected correctly?
Does your computer's operating system support the BR-80?
For information concerning the operating environment needed for using USB,
please refer to the Roland website (http://www.roland.com).
Does your computer support USB 2.0?
The BR-80 will not work with USB 1.1 or earlier.
Use a computer that supports USB 2.0.
Could the USB mode be set to Storage?
Is the USB driver installed correctly?
